Choose a Day

2025-08-07 St. Louis Cardinals (SLN)

Today is day 132 of the 2025 season

NL Central 2025-08-07

TmWLBATPITCHURdPE
MIL704457.457.94.80.8
CHN664886.926.46.8-7.2
CIN6056-0.738.6-2.5-3.4
SLN5858-5.2-7.5-2.53.2
PIT5066-94.236.012.5-6.4

Vegas Status for SLN 2025-08-07

Vegas column shows how the betting community predicted Win Percentage. Real is real Win Percentage for that team. For column % won or lost betting For that team each game. Against % betting against.

TmVegasRealForAgainst#Bets
SLN0.5080.500-2.2%-5.9%116

Top Ten Players for SLN 2025-08-07

WAA column shows value accumulated playing for all teams including SLN this season.

RankWAANamePos
+095+ 2.32Kyle LeahyPITCH
+127+ 1.92Phil MatonPITCH
+129+ 1.87JoJo RomeroPITCH
+154+ 1.7Willson Contreras1B
+169+ 1.6Riley O'BrienPITCH
XXXXX 1.27Ryan HelsleyPITCH
XXXXX 1.15Nolan Gorman3B
XXXXX 1.14Steven MatzPITCH
XXXXX 1.12Ivan HerreraDH
XXXXX 1.08Matt SvansonPITCH

Show All

_